Ovarian cysts are fluid-filled sacs that develop on the ovaries and often go unnoticed. While most ovarian cysts are harmless and resolve on their own, some can lead to significant discomfort and may require medical intervention. For women facing this issue, laparoscopic surgery has emerged as an effective treatment option.
Understanding Laparoscopic Surgery
Laparoscopic surgery involves making small incisions in the abdomen to insert a camera (laparoscope) and specialized instruments. This technique allows surgeons to visualize the ovaries and surrounding structures on a monitor, making it possible to diagnose and treat various conditions with precision. In comparison to traditional open surgery, laparoscopic procedure results in less postoperative pain, minimal scarring, and a shorter recovery time.
Effectiveness in Treating Ovarian Cysts
Accurate Diagnosis: The main advantage of laparoscopic surgery is its ability to provide an accurate diagnosis. During the procedure, surgeons can directly visualize the cyst and surrounding tissues. If necessary, they can perform biopsies to determine whether the cyst is benign or malignant, allowing for timely and appropriate treatment.
- Removal of Cysts: Laparoscopic surgery can effectively remove ovarian cysts, including large or complex ones that may not respond to other treatments. Surgeons can remove the cyst while preserving healthy ovarian tissue, which is crucial for maintaining hormonal balance and fertility.
- Reduced Recovery Time: Women undergoing laparoscopic surgery generally experience faster recovery compared to those who have open surgery. Most patients can start with their normal activities within a week, minimizing time away from work and family. - Less Pain and Scarring: Because laparoscopic procedures involve smaller incisions, patients often report less postoperative pain and minimal scarring. This benefit is particularly important for women concerned about the cosmetic outcome of their surgery.
- Lower Risk of Complications: Laparoscopic surgery is associated with fewer complications than traditional open surgery. The reduced risk of infections and bleeding makes it a safer option for many patients.
